    Sibling Showdown: Jude and Jobe Bellingham Make Waves in Thrilling Tournament Clash

    June 22, 2025 Sports No Comments4 Mins Read
    Share
    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email

    Jobe Bellingham made headlines during his recent appearance in the ongoing tournament, drawing comparisons with his older brother, Jude Bellingham, who has been making quite a name for himself. The event marked a significant milestone for Jobe, reminiscent of the moment five years ago when Jude scored on his debut for Borussia Dortmund, leading them to a resounding 5-0 victory in the German Cup. With different paths but similar styles, the Bellingham brothers continue to capture the attention of football fans around the world.

    During an encounter against Liga MX’s Pachuca, Jude notched an impressive goal in the 35th minute, showcasing his exceptional striking ability. This pivotal moment not only contributed to his team’s lead but also marked a sweet success for Xabi Alonso, as it constituted his first win in charge as Real Madrid’s manager. Post-match, Jude humorously reflected on the familial rivalry, revealing, “Everyone’s been caning me yesterday saying he’s better than me.” He acknowledged Jobe’s recent achievement with a lively spirit, emphasizing the friendly competition as he stated, “I had to do something today. We’re 1-1 now and we’ll see for the rest of the tournament.”

    Currently, Real Madrid, following their recent triumph, finds itself at the top of Group H while Borussia Dortmund stands second in Group F. The potential for a knock-out stage clash between the Bellingham siblings has fans eagerly anticipating their next matches, as both brothers continue to shine brightly in their respective teams.

    Despite their victory, Real Madrid faced a fierce challenge from Pachuca, who outshot them comprehensively with a count of 25 shots to 8 in the match. Early in the game, the dynamic of the match shifted dramatically when Raul Asencio committed a grave error, receiving a red card for a foul on Salomon Rondon as he raced toward goal. The early ejection put Madrid at a numerical disadvantage, making their victory even more impressive.

    Reflecting on the match’s challenges, Jude Bellingham remarked, “I think we stayed together.” He acknowledged Asencio’s misstep but conveyed confidence in the team’s resilience, mentioning, “It’s fine, he’s young and it’s going to happen.” Jude stressed the unity displayed by the team in overcoming adversity and also praised Thibaut Courtois for his exceptional performance. Courtois, the Real Madrid goalkeeper and key player of the match, made a stellar ten saves, contributing significantly to the team’s ability to maintain their lead despite being a man down.

    Bellingham lauded Courtois further, stating, “That’s why he’s there. We want to make him less busy next time, but that’s why he’s there. He’s the best in the world for a reason, and he saved us.” The mutual respect and admiration for their teammate certainly underline the cohesiveness within the squad.

    Xabi Alonso also shared his thoughts post-game, giving due credit to Courtois for his reliability and composure under pressure. He expressed, “We are so happy that we have Thibaut in goal. Through many games, he has shown he is so reliable.” He acknowledged the intensity they faced playing with ten men and commended the team’s collaborative effort during an untenable situation.

    However, Alonso did not hold back when addressing Asencio’s role in the match, hinting at the need for corrective discussions in the future. He remarked, “We will have time to talk. But he needs to learn from experiences and this one came early in the game.” While Alonso’s comments were stern, it was clear that he also recognized the opportunity for growth through learning from mistakes.

    With this match, the spirit of competitiveness and family ties among the Bellinghams continue to weave an intriguing narrative in the world of football, promising thrilling encounters ahead as the tournament progresses. The stage is set for future showdowns and highlights as both Jude and Jobe aim to leave their mark in the beautiful game.
